Double-glazed windows are more energy efficient.

When it comes to energy efficiency, double-glazed windows are the best. If you live in the middle of a cold or hot climate they can make a significant difference in your cooling and heating costs. There are many options to choose from. Secondary glazing is a choice which attaches a second glass pane to the window. Triple glazing adds an additional glass pane an existing window. The material used and available features will determine which option you pick.

An effective method to identify which window is most efficient in terms of energy efficiency is to look at its U-value. Windows with a lower U value have a better insulation capacity and will retain more heat. They can also prevent condensation from forming, reducing the possibility of moisture damage to other areas of the room.

They can also be produced by using a low-emissivity coating to cut down on heat transfer through the unit. Low-e glass has a microscopic layer of metal oxide that lets light to pass through while reducing amount of heat radiated off the glass.

Some windows even have gas in between the panes to slow the flow of heat such as argon. A window that is insulated can help keep the temperature of your home stable and warm in winter, and cool in the summer.

The British Fenestration Rating Council (BFRC) has developed an energy rating system to show the effectiveness of windows. In general, an Energy Star-rated window has a U-factor of 0.30 to 0.60.

Double-glazed windows offer superior thermal performance, however their price can increase over time. There are other options to offer better insulation, like a composite frame that includes aluminum and wood on the inside with plastic or aluminum on the outside. This kind of window is perfect for homes and conservation areas built in environmentally sensitive zones.

Another benefit of double glazed window fittings-glazed windows is their reduction in noise. Soundproofing is an important factor when building or remodeling the home. A well-insulated window can help to prevent noise from escaping.

Signs that you require a window replacement

If you're seeking an energy efficient method to improve the comfort of your home you might consider replacing your windows. You will reduce your expenses and increase the quality of life of your family. You should be aware of the indications that your windows require to be replaced.

The most obvious sign is having difficulty opening or closing your windows. This could be due to a malfunctioning spring or roller system.

Condensation buildup between your windows' panes is another sign. This can make your windows more costly to maintain and may also be a danger. It could cause leaks, which can increase the cost of cooling and heating, as well as impacting the comfort of your home.

Examining your windows visually are a must. You'll likely notice a variety of obvious defects, including cracked or warped frames, or glass that is loose. These issues must be rectified quickly.

Drafts are another sign that can be seen. Air leaks can occur when a seal isn't perfected or in the event that the frame isn't strong enough. This can cause cold drafts in winter and warm air in summer.

The right windows will enhance the comfort and safety of your home and add to your property's curb appeal. Look for a manufacturer that has a track record of manufacturing high-quality windows. For example, Next Door & Window in Illinois provides energy efficient windows, such as Low E3 and Low E2/ERS models.

One of the most obvious signs that you're in need of new windows is if you notice gaps between the panes of your windows. This should be addressed immediately.

Last but not least, you should inspect your windows for insects. Your home could become more dangerous and more prone to insect infestations if they are too close to your windows. Repairing damaged wood or glass you'll be able to protect your family from pests, and decrease the risk of water seepage.

Although these are the more obvious signs that you need a new window, there are many less-known reasons to think about. The installation process is just as important as the product. Having an unqualified installer do the job can leave you with a subpar product that has to be replaced in no time.

Work environment for a window fitter

As a window fitting technician, you are responsible for the installation of windows and doors and clearing up leftover materials after the job is completed. You must possess a passion for construction and be familiar with fittings. You will need to complete an apprenticeship or a college course to work in this industry. You could work as a window installer for yourself or on a larger job dependent on your skills and experience. The salary you earn will depend on your qualifications, your employer, and the amount of overtime you have to work.

Alternately, you can pursue an intermediate apprenticeship in fenestration carpentry or bench joinery with a specialist fenestration or carpentry company. It is expected that you will work at least 30 hours per week at work and divide your time between school or the workplace. Once you have completed your training you will be employed by your company.
